statetakehome-mcp
Enables AI assistants to compute US take-home pay, self-employment taxes, and capital gains taxes for the 2026 tax year using the engine from statetakehome.com.
README
statetakehome-mcp
A Model Context Protocol (MCP) server that puts a full US paycheck-tax engine directly at your AI assistant's fingertips: federal brackets, all 50 states + DC, FICA, self-employment tax, and capital gains — all for the 2026 tax year, and all sourced from the same engine that powers statetakehome.com.
Why it's different: most take-home-pay calculators stop at "gross minus taxes." This one also understands the 2026 OBBBA (One Big Beautiful Bill Act) landscape — the current-year federal brackets and thresholds it ships with already reflect the post-OBBBA baseline, so estimates stay accurate as the rules that shaped the 2026 tax year continue to roll out.
Quick Start
No installation needed — run it with npx.
Claude Desktop / Claude Code
Add to your MCP config (claude_desktop_config.json or .mcp.json):
{
"mcpServers": {
"statetakehome": {
"command": "npx",
"args": ["-y", "statetakehome-mcp"]
}
}
}
Cursor
Add to .cursor/mcp.json:
{
"mcpServers": {
"statetakehome": {
"command": "npx",
"args": ["-y", "statetakehome-mcp"]
}
}
}
Restart your client and the three tools below become available.
Tools
1. us_take_home_pay
Net pay for a US W-2 employee: federal income tax, state income tax (all 50 states + DC), Social Security, Medicare, Additional Medicare, and state-specific extras (CA SDI, OR transit tax, etc.). Handles pre-tax 401(k) and health-insurance deductions and returns a per-paycheck breakdown for every pay frequency.
Example call:
{
"gross": 75000,
"state": "CA",
"filingStatus": "single"
}
Response (abridged, from the live engine):
{
"result": {
"gross": 75000,
"federalTax": 7670,
"stateTax": 2940.85,
"socialSecurity": 4650,
"medicare": 1087.5,
"totalTax": 17323.35,
"takeHome": 57676.65,
"effectiveRate": 0.2310,
"perPaycheck": { "biweekly": 2218.33, "monthly": 4806.39 }
}
}
The same input with "state": "TX" (no state income tax) returns stateTax: 0 and takeHome: 61592.5 — $3,915.85 higher on the same gross pay.
2. self_employment_tax
Schedule SE self-employment tax (15.3% on 92.35% of net profit, split into the Social Security and Medicare portions), the 0.9% Additional Medicare surtax, federal income tax, an optional state income tax, and a quarterly estimated-payment figure.
Example call:
{
"netProfit": 90000,
"filingStatus": "single",
"state": "TX"
}
Response (abridged, from the live engine):
{
"result": {
"netProfit": 90000,
"seTax": 12716.6,
"seTaxDeduction": 6358.3,
"federalIncomeTax": 9571.17,
"totalTax": 22287.77,
"quarterlyEstimate": 5571.94,
"setAsidePct": 0.2477
}
}
3. capital_gains_tax
Federal capital gains tax — long-term stacked 0%/15%/20% bands or short-term ordinary rates — plus the 3.8% Net Investment Income Tax (NIIT) above the MAGI threshold, and an optional state estimate (most states tax gains as ordinary income).
Example call:
{
"gain": 50000,
"ordinaryTaxableIncome": 80000,
"filingStatus": "single",
"term": "long"
}
Response (abridged, from the live engine):
{
"result": {
"gain": 50000,
"taxableGain": 50000,
"federalTax": 7500,
"niit": 0,
"totalTax": 7500,
"netProceeds": 42500,
"ltcgRate": 0.15
}
}
Data & Methodology
- Tax year: 2026.
- Federal brackets & standard deduction: IRS Rev. Proc. 2025-32.
- State brackets & standard deductions: Tax Foundation — State Individual Income Tax Rates and Brackets, as of January 1, 2026, cross-checked against individual state Departments of Revenue.
- FICA: current Social Security wage base and Medicare rates, including the 0.9% Additional Medicare surtax.
- Capital gains: long-term bands and the NIIT threshold per Rev. Proc. 2025-32, cross-checked against Tax Foundation and Schwab.
- Every response includes a
sourceblock naming the underlying publication and areference_urlpointing to the matching calculator on the live site for further reading and methodology notes:- https://statetakehome.com/
- https://statetakehome.com/self-employment-tax-calculator
- https://statetakehome.com/capital-gains-tax-calculator
The calculation code in this package is the same engine that runs statetakehome.com, kept in sync by hand — it is not a reimplementation.
